top of page

Visit of the Chillon's Castle


The Chillon’s Castle is a medieval fortress on the shores of Lake Geneva near Montreux, and it is one of the most visited monument in Switzerland.

The rocky island on which the castle is built, was both a natural protection and a strategic location to control the passage between northern and southern Europe.

You can choose to visit the Castle with a guided tour, which will provide you with all the important information about the history of this splendid Castle, or you can choose to make the tour of the Castle at your own path, with the help of a brochure available in 17 languages. 

During your visit, you will go through the underground, the courtyard, the different rooms, the chapel, the weapon room and even the little beach beside it. 

*** Included in this activity: Transportation to the Castle, entrance fee and transportation back to the city center of Lausanne

bottom of page